Zelkova schneideriana Hand.-Mazz belongs to Zelkova Spach genus of Ulmaceae family, it's unique specie in China. Zelkova schneideriana had been ranked as second focused protection wild plant of China. The paper aimed at preserving the fine characteristics given from Zelkova schneideriana Makino parents. All of the efforts was focused on studying cutting propagating technology and rooting mechanism of Zelkova schneideriana, the results as following:The results of cutting propagating experiment showed that the rootage percent was the highest when the soft wood cutting was soaked in ABA200mg·L-1 for 4 hours on the 22th June,. Meanwhile rooting percentage is as high as 73.5%, other rooting morphological indexes was better than different dealing. All examinations showed external hormone played an important role in rooting of plant significantly, and the effect of ABT rootage powder was the best; the surviving percent was the highest when the cuttings were soaked for 4 hours and the external hormone concentration was 200mg·L-1; the cutting propagating was better at the time of the 22th June approximately; the planting material and the cutting dimension had little of effection on surviving; and the bergeon materials should be cut from the lower part of the tree crown.The studying of rooting mechanism indicated that some indexes about the content of nutrient manifested a given rule with the development of rooting, such as soluble sugar, amylum, soluble albumen, total nitrogen, total phosphor and the rato of C/N etc. The content of soluble sugar and amylum had a downtrend at the forming period of callus and all the period of rooting, perhaps the soluble sugar and amylum provided energy for callus and rooting process; whereafter, the content of nutrient had an uptrend, then indicated no fluctuating. It can be explained as the energy requirement is reduction after rooting. The rato of C/N manifested the rooting ability in some extent.Both the fluctuating of the content of nutrient and the hormone in burgeon like IAA, ABA, GA3 and ZR etc promoted the rooting process. The fluctuating curve of the content of hormone in burgeon can indicate the process of the forming of callus and rooting. It is favor that there is the high ratio of IAA/ABA advantaged the rooting process.The experiment of the activity of IAAO and POD indicated that the activity of IAAO and POD correlated with rooting significantly. In the beginning of the rooting, the activity of IAAO and POD rised, maybe the overfull IAA in burgeon was oxidated, the inducement of root anlage was impulsed. Later, as the completing of rooting, the activity of IAAO and POD manifested little fluctuating.If the rooting environment was suitable, the fluctuating of all nutrient and hormone in burgeon influenced the whole process of rooting, as well as the proper cutting propagating technology may promote the rooting surviving percent significantly.
